Carvel Ice Cream Cake is a beloved dessert made through layers of creamy ice cream, crispy chocolate crunchies, and rich frosting. This iconic treat, originating from American ice cream parlor traditions, combines textures and flavors for a celebratory experience. Typically, it includes vanilla and chocolate ice cream, a center layer of signature chocolate cookie crunchies, and a decorative whipped topping or frosting. As a dessert, it contains sugar, dairy, and fat, making it a high-calorie indulgence, best enjoyed in moderation. While it provides a source of simple carbohydrates and calcium from the ice cream, the cake is not considered a health-focused food. It is intended to be a festive treat for birthdays, special occasions, or simply rewarding yourself with something sweet.
